Between the artwork upstairs and the crypt underneath, there’s plenty of time for quiet reflection as you leave the city hustle and noise at the door.

The Paris Museum Pass is accepted here.

My second visit here. I enjoy coming here to remember important historical figures like political leaders, artists, and writers. Came today for a concert. Tip: if you want to avoid the normal entry fee, come for a free concert.
